Advance Directives Assistance: An advance directive tells your doctor what kind of care you would like to have if you become unable to make medical decisions (if you are in a coma, for example). If you are admitted to the hospital, the hospital staff will probably talk to you about advance directives. A good advance directive describes the kind of treatment you would want depending on how sick you are. To find out more, please call (810) 257-9220.

Closed Captioned Television:  Closed Captioning allows persons with hearing disabilities to access television programming. Captioning displays the audio portion of programming as text superimposed over the video.

Pastoral Care and Spiritual Services: Hurley Medical Center recognizes the spiritual component of healing and wellness. Through its Pastoral Care Department, Hurley Medical Center offers support for the spirit on a day-to-day basis. Directed by a Hurley Chaplain, the department includes community chaplains who will be happy to visit patients and family members during their stay, regardless of religious affiliation. The ministry of listening and prayer is available by patient request. Please tell your nurse, or call (810) 257-9517.

Public Safety:  The Department of Public Safety is the in-house security department at Hurley. The staff is professionally trained and offers many services, including car unlocks, jump starts, visitor restrictions and escorts. Most services are available 24 hours a day and can be requested by calling (810) 257-9121.

Valuables/Lost Items: Patients are asked not to bring items of value to the hospital. If you do bring a valuable item, please have it deposited in the safe in the Emergency Department or the Cashier’s Office. We will provide a written receipt for all deposited items. This receipt must be presented when you withdraw them. The hospital does not accept responsibility for any items of value unless they are deposited in the safe. If you lose something, please notify your nurse immediately, and we will make every effort to help find it. Unclaimed articles are turned in to the Public Safety Office and held for 30 days. To inquire about lost articles, or to file a report, call the Public Safety Department at (810) 257-9121.
